Why does it rain and at other times why does it not rain

When warm, wet air rises, it cools, and water vapor condenses out to form clouds. A cloud is made up of small drops of water or ice crystals, depending on its height and how cold is the surrounding air.

Explain the fluid-mosaic model of membranes. how are proteins found at membranes described? what types of side chains would be f

He fluid mosaic model of the plasma membrane. The fluid mosaic model of the plasma membrane describes the plasma membrane as a fluid combination of phospholipids, cholesterol, and proteins. Carbohydrates attached to lipids (glycolipids) and to proteins (glycoproteins) extend from the outward-facing surface of the membrane<span>.</span>
